Lithotripsy pain medication
WebYou had lithotripsy, a medical procedure that uses high frequency sound (shock) waves or a laser to break up stones in your kidney, bladder, or ureter (the tube that carries urine from your kidneys to your bladder). The sound waves or laser beam breaks the stones into tiny pieces. What to Expect at Home Webwww.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ov
